        How does the heat and light work?

        Gentle heat increases local blood flow and helps relax tense muscles around your lower abdomen or back. The light setting adds a soothing warmth-and-glow bonus alongside the heat — it's a comfort feature, not a medical treatment.

        Is it safe to use daily, not just during my period?

        Yes — Luma is designed for regular, even daily, use with auto shut-off, overheat protection, non-toxic materials, and a low-voltage design. As with any heat product, avoid use while sleeping and don't apply directly to bare skin for extended periods.

        Will this help with my endometriosis pain?

        Many people with endo find that heat helps ease cramping, lower-back tension, and general pelvic muscle tension day to day. It's not a treatment for endometriosis itself, and it tends to help less with bowel-related pain specifically — everyone's experience is different, so we'd rather set honest expectations than promise a cure. If you're dealing with persistent or severe pain, please talk to your doctor.

        Can I start using it before my period even begins?

        Yes. Some people find that using heat proactively in the days leading up to their period takes the edge off before cramping fully sets in. There's no downside to starting early — just follow the usage guidelines for daily wear.

        Is it safe to sleep in?

        We don't recommend it. Like most electric heat products, extended unsupervised use isn't advised — Luma's auto shut-off means it won't stay on all night if you doze off, but for planned overnight comfort, a hot water bottle or microwavable option is the safer choice.
